Abstract
In the paper, we investigate a modified version of the shrinking target problem in beta dynamical systems which is induced by the β-transformation Tβ:xâβx(mod1). The Hausdorff dimension of the limâsup setW(f,Ï)={xâ[0,1):|Tβnxâf(x)|<Ï(n)for infinitely many nâN} is determined, where f:[0,1]â[0,1] is a Lipschitz function and Ï is a positive function defined on N. The set W(f,Ï) can be viewed as a dynamical analogue of the inhomogeneous Diophantine approximation in which the inhomogeneous factor is allowed to vary.
